Where is Norwegian Museum of Science and Technology?

Where is Norwegian Museum of Science and Technology located?

Norwegian Museum of Science and Technology, Norwegian Museum of Science and Technology, Norway (approx. 59.966667°, 10.782778°)


Where is Norwegian Museum of Science and Technology on the map?